Features & Specifications:
- 56″ V-Nose w/6″ Radius
- 3/4″ Decking
- White
- 24′ Box + 56″ V-Nose
- Rear Door Opening WxH: 76″x70″
- Front Door Opening WxH: 54″x68″
- Interior Height: 73″
- Tapered Front & Rear Ramps
- Rear Door Canopy w/Lights
- (2) 14″x14″ Fuel Doors w/ Paddle Handles
- All Aluminum Construction, Integrated Frame
- 2″x5″ Subframe Tubing
- 16″ O/C Wall Studs
- 24″ O/C Floor & Roof Studs
- 030 Screwless Skin, Bonded on Seams
- One-Piece Aluminum Roof
- 12″ Kickplate
- Interior Cove Trim
- 3″ Exterior Trim
- (2) 3K Braked Leaf Spring Axles w/4″ Drop
- 15″ Silver Mod Wheels
- 2″ Straight Pull Coupler (10K)
- 2000 lb Jack w/Foot
- 7-Way Round Power Connection
- 24″ Stoneguard
- Front & Rear Ramps w/Spring Assist
- Full Length Slide Tracks w/Sliding D-Rings
- (2) Interior Dome Lights w/Wall Switch
- LED Exterior Lighting
- Salem Vents
- 4-Year Limited Warranty

Tire pressure deserves more attention than it usually gets. Trailer tires run at higher pressures than car tires and lose condition sitting still, so check them before a trip rather than during one.
